Incident response should begin with action

When an alert fires, the responder may know the hostname, IP address, switch name, or asset tag, but that does not always translate into a clear physical location. They still need to know which rack the device is in, which row to walk to, which port is connected, and whether the CMDB location is correct.

Responders often jump between DCIM, CMDB, monitoring tools, spreadsheets, old diagrams, and messaging threads before they can start real work. That delay increases mean time to locate, mean time to respond, and mean time to recover.

Packet loss response without tool-hopping

A monitoring alert shows packet loss from a critical application server connected through a top-of-rack switch. The on-call engineer needs to confirm switch, port, cable path, and physical rack location.

With RackTrack, the engineer opens the switch's most recent scan, confirms the exact port and cable path, and starts the runbook from the correct rack. The result is faster location, fewer detours, and quicker recovery.
